If you need to have other supplies, you can get in touch with us. Q3: what is the torque suggest?A3: torque is the weight that the motor can load at a specified voltage and velocity. If the motor you bought is 12v 12rpm, its corresponding torque is 70kg.cm. This indicates that when the motor is at 12v and 12rpm, it can load 70kg objects with a diameter of 1cm. If the iameter of the load is 10cm, then the rated torque is 7kg. Please do not exceed the rated load in the course of the use of the motor, normally the equipment is prone to use and tear. This fall: how to change rotation path?A4: you should modify wiring polarity to alter rotation route. Q5: how to adjust speed?A5: you can buy our below speed controller, to change velocity from -10rpm. Q6: what do “self locking” indicate?A6: It is the characteristic of this motor, when electrical power off, this motor also has lock torque, can not effortless to move by other power. It can be used for some special purpose. This sort of as Anti-theft sliding doorways. Q7: what takes place when a voltage of 18V is linked to a 12V motor or an 18V motor?A7: The 12V motor link 18V voltage will be broken, and the 24V motor link 18V voltage will affect his pace and torque, and will not even operate. 1\This table lists some motors parameters, others please refer to specific parameters of rs-555.htm" 2\Afier connecting motor and gearbox which is named gearmotor the output torque:motor torque X reduction ratio X gearing efficiency;output speed:motor speed / reduction ratio.
